1. Leaf DifferenceThe Java cotton tree has 5 to 9 leaflets, which are oblong-lanceolate, short and acuminate, gradually becoming pointed at the base, 5 to 16 cm long and 1.5 to 4.5 cm wide. The leaves are entire or have sparse fine serrations near the top. The leaves are glabrous on both sides and covered with white frost on the back. The petiole is 7 to 14 cm long. The leaves of the beautiful silk cotton tree are alternate, palmately compound, with 3 to 7 leaflets, mostly 5, obovate-oblong or ovate, the middle leaflet is larger, about 7 to 14 cm long, with serrations on the upper edge, the tip of the leaves is pointed or gradually pointed, and the base is wedge-shaped. 2. Flower DifferencesMost of the Java cotton flowers are clustered in the upper leaf axils. The pedicels are 2.5 to 5 cm long, sometimes solitary, and the petals are obovate-oblong, 2.5 to 4 cm long. The flowers of the beautiful silk cotton tree are relatively large, with 1 to 3 flowers growing in the axillary or several flowers clustered at the end of the branches. They are slightly fragrant, with a cup-shaped, green calyx and 5 petals that are pink or red, with yellow or white petals with purple spots at the base, or completely white with yellow inside, and wavy and slightly curled edges. |
